ARBIL, IRAQ: A member of the Kurdistan Communist Party counts money after receiving his donation in Arbil, northern Iraq 28 January 2005. Campaigning by candidates for Sunday's election in Iraq officially ended on this morning, as Iraqi exiles in 14 countries across the globe began voting. Insurgents, including Al-Qaeda front man Abu Musab al-Zarqawi, have vowed to wreck the country's first democratic vote in decades.AFP PHOTO/Mustafa Ozer (Photo credit should read MUSTAFA OZER/AFP via Getty Images)
